The Council of Samastha Women’s Colleges (CSWC) was established in 2019 and is headquartered in Chelari, Kerala, India. It is an academic governing body that operates under the supervision of the Samastha Kerala Islam Matha Vidhyabhyasa Board (Reg. no. 194/85) and oversees colleges for women offering Fadhila-Fadheela Courses. These courses were developed under the guidance of visionary leaders of Samastha Kerala Jem-iyyathul Ulama. The CSWC aims to educate and train talented female scholars and propagators in moral, spiritual, and standard Islamic knowledge, as well as contemporary and scientific studies.....

It was in the context of a desire to do some service for religion that Hussain Haji introduced the **Falila – Faleela** courses under the **Samastha Kerala Jam’iyyathul Ulama**. Observing the circumstances of the time, it was understood that the religious and secular education of girls was a pressing need. The responsibility for this initiative was entrusted to **Abdul khader Hudawi**. This marked the beginning of **BKR Falila College**.
